The Project Quantity Surveyor Role
The successful Project Quantity Surveyor will become part of a multidisciplinary consultancy with a strong reputation for delivering client-focused cost, project, and development management services across both public and private sectors.
As a Project Quantity Surveyor, you will take ownership of project delivery from initial feasibility through to final account. You will work directly with clients, manage budgets, and ensure effective cost control and contract administration throughout. The role also includes opportunities to mentor junior team members and contribute to a collaborative team environment.
Project Quantity Surveyor Responsibilities:
* Deliver full pre- and post-contract Quantity Surveying services
* Prepare cost plans, budgets, tender documents, and procurement strategies
* Lead or support contractor selection and tender processes
* Administer contracts and manage change control procedures
* Monitor costs and produce accurate project financial reports
* Provide value engineering input and commercial advice
* Assist with mentoring and supporting junior colleagues
